MS KB2962824: Update Rollup of Revoked Non-Compliant UEFI Modules

The remote host is missing Microsoft KB2962824, an update that revokes the digital signatures of four third-party Unified Extensible Firmware Interface UEFI modules. This update prevents the modules from being loaded on systems where UEFI Secure Boot is enabled. C Tenable Network Security, Inc...

CVE-2012-5218

The CVE-2012-5218 case involves HP ElitePad 900 laptops/tablets with BIOS F.0x prior to F.01 Update 1.0.0.8. The root cause is that Secure Boot was not enabled, allowing local attackers to bypass BIOS restrictions and boot unauthorized operating systems via unspecified vectors. Documented impact ...
